Is anyone else frustrated with Mahalo bugs?
I wanted to edit a reply to add more information/sources but clicking the edit link, within the 1 hour time limit, did nothing! Is it just me or anyone else also experiencing annoying bugs. What bugs have you experienced?

In your email mention..
- When the Problem happened.
- What you were doing when you experienced the problem.
- What type of browser and connection you are using.
- Do you have a screenshot or video of bug?
Thanks, the more people who report an issue, the more information we gain about the bug and the easier it becomes to fix.

Mahalo Dollars are the currency of Mahalo Answers.
Each Mahalo Dollar costs $1.
Once you earn more than 40 Mahalo Dollars, you can request to be paid via PayPal. Each Mahalo Dollar is currently worth $0.75 when paid out via PayPal. Learn More
